Socialization
The process through which individuals learn and acquire the values, norms, and behaviors that are necessary for functioning within their society.
Society Shapes
The concept that societal structures and cultural norms influence individual behaviors, perceptions, and social identities.
Psychic Energy
A concept in psychology representing the force behind human thoughts, emotions, and behaviors, often linked to Freudian psychoanalytic theory.
Biological Drives
Innate impulses that motivate behavior and are essential for survival, such as hunger, thirst, and the drive for reproduction.
